Table A-5. Telnet Session Options

Telnet Session

Possible Settings: Enable, Disable

Default Setting: Enable

Specifies if the Termination Unit will respond to a Telnet session request from a Telnet client on an interconnected IP network.

Enable ± Allows Telnet sessions between the unit and a Telnet client.

Disable ± No Telnet sessions allowed.

Telnet Login Required

Possible Settings: Enable, Disable

Default Setting: Disable

Specifies whether a user ID and password are required to access to the ATI through a Telnet session. Login IDs are created with a password and access level. Refer to Creating a Login in Chapter 7, Security.

Enable ± Security is enabled. When access is attempted via Telnet, the user is prompted for a Login ID and password.

Disable ± No Login required for a Telnet session.

Session Access Level

Possible Settings: Administrator, Operator

Default Setting: Administrator

The Telnet session access level is interrelated with the access level of the Login ID. Refer to ATI Access Levels in Chapter 7, Security for more information.

Administrator ± This is the higher access level, permitting full control of the 7984 Termination Unit. Access level is determined by the Login ID. If Telnet Login Required is disabled, the session access level is Administrator.

Operator ± This is the lower access level, permitting read-only access to status and configuration screens.

Inactivity Timeout

Possible Settings: Enable, Disable

Default Setting: Disable

Provides automatic logoff of a Telnet session.

Enable ± The Telnet session terminates automatically after the Disconnect Time. Set the Disconnect time (in minutes) after enabling Inactivity Timeout.

Disable ± A Telnet session will not be closed due to inactivity.

Disconnect Time (Minutes)

Possible Settings: 1 ± 60

Default Setting: 5

Number of minutes of user inactivity before a Telnet session terminates automatically. Time out is based on no keyboard activity.

HDisconnect Time (minutes) appears only when the Inactivity Timeout option is enabled.

1 to 60 ± The Telnet session is closed after the selected number of minutes.
